微信小程序 navigationbar怎么配置
Posted
tags:
篇首语:本文由小常识网(cha138.com)小编为大家整理,主要介绍了微信小程序 navigationbar怎么配置相关的知识,希望对你有一定的参考价值。
参考技术A 微信小程序——配置 以下就是小编对小程序配置的资料进行的系统的整理,希望能对开发者有帮助。 我们使用app.json文件来对微信小程序进行全局配置,决定页面文件的路径、窗口表现、设置网络超时时间、设置多 tab 等。 以下是一个包含了所有配置选项的简单配置app.json : "pages": [ "pages/index/index", "pages/logs/index" ], "window": "navigationBarTitleText": "Demo" , "tabBar": "list": [ "pagePath": "pages/index/index", "text": "首页" , "pagePath": "pages/logs/logs", "text": "日志" ] , "networkTimeout": "request": 10000, "downloadFile": 10000 , "debug": true app.json 配置项列表 属性 类型 必填 描述 pages Array 是 设置页面路径 window Object 否 设置默认页面的窗口表现 tabBar Object 否 设置底部 tab 的表现 networkTimeout Object 否 设置网络超时时间 debug Boolean 否 设置是否开启 debug 模式 pages 接受一个数组,每一项都是字符串,来指定小程序由哪些页面组成。每一项代表对应页面的【路径+文件名】信息,数组的第一项代表小程序的初始页面。小程序中新增/减少页面,都需要对 pages 数组进行修改。 文件名不需要写文件后缀,因为框架会自动去寻找路径.json,.js,.wxml,.wxss的四个文件进行整合。 如开发目录为: pages/ pages/index/index.wxml pages/index/index.js pages/index/index.wxss pages/logs/logs.wxml pages/logs/logs.js app.js app.json app.wxss 则,我们需要在 app.json 中写 "pages":[ "pages/index/index" "pages/logs/logs" ] window 用于设置小程序的状态栏、导航条、标题、窗口背景色。 属性 类型 默认值 描述 navigationBarBackgroundColor HexColor #000000 导航栏背景颜色,如"#000000" navigationBarTextStyle String white 导航栏标题颜色,仅支持 black/white navigationBarTitleText String 导航栏标题文字内容 backgroundColor HexColor #ffffff 窗口的背景色 backgroundTextStyle String dark 下拉背景字体、loading 图的样式,仅支持 dark/light 注:HexColor(十六进制颜色值),如"#ff00ff" 如 app.json : "window": "navigationBarBackgroundColor": "#ffffff", "navigationBarTextStyle": "black", "navigationBarTitleText": "微信接口功能演示", "backgroundColor": "#eeeeee", "backgroundTextStyle": "light" tabBar 如果我们的小程序是一个多 tab 应用(客户端窗口的底部有tab栏可以切换页面),那么我们可以通过 tabBar 配置项指定 tab 栏的表现,以及 tab 切换时显示的对应页面。 tabBar 是一个数组,只能配置最少2个、最多5个 tab,tab 按数组的顺序排序。 属性说明: 属性 类型 必填 默认值 描述 color HexColor 是 tab 上的文字默认颜色 selectedColor HexColor 是 tab 上的文字选中时的颜色 backgroundColor HexColor 是 tab 的背景色 borderStyle String 否 black tabbar上边框的颜色, 仅支持 black/white list Array 是 tab 的列表,详见 list 属性说明,最少2个、最多5个 tab 其中 list 接受一个数组,数组中的每个项都是一个对象,其属性值如下: 属性 类型 必填 说明 pagePath String 是 页面路径,必须在 pages 中先定义 text String 是 tab 上按钮文字 iconPath String 是 图片路径,icon 大小限制为40kb selectedIconPath String 是 选中时的图片路径,icon 大小限制为40kb networkTimeout 可以设置各种网络请求的超时时间。 属性说明: 属性 类型 必填 说明 request Number 否 wx.request的超时时间,单位毫秒 connectSocket Number 否 wx.connectSocket的超时时间,单位毫秒 uploadFile Number 否 wx.uploadFile的超时时间,单位毫秒 downloadFile Number 否 wx.downloadFile的超时时间,单位毫秒 debug 可以在开发者工具中开启 debug 模式,在开发者工具的控制台面板,调试信息以 info 的形式给出,其信息有Page的注册,页面路由,数据更新,事件触发 。 可以帮助开发者快速定位一些常见的问题。 page.json 每一个小程序页面也可以使用.json文件来对本页面的窗口表现进行配置。 页面的配置比app.json全局配置简单得多,只是设置 app.json 中的 window 配置项的内容,页面中配置项会覆盖 app.json 的 window 中相同的配置项。 页面的.json只能设置 window 相关的配置项,以决定本页面的窗口表现,所以无需写 window 这个键,如: "navigationBarBackgroundColor": "#ffffff", "navigationBarTextStyle": "black", "navigationBarTitleText": "微信接口功能演示", "backgroundColor": "#eeeeee", "backgroundTextStyle": "light" 感谢阅读,希望能帮助到大家,谢谢大家对本站的支持!微信小程序怎么数大量数量
小程序官方数据统计微信小程序的后台提供了数据统计功能,你可以从后台看到比较全面的概览数据。同时还有实时数据,你可以看到实时有多少人正在使用你的产品。
小程序参数配置页面
微信小程序也提供了一定的行为数据,这是是微信小程序正在内测的页面,给我的感觉是非常复杂。
如果你要监测某个行为,你要挑选行为类型,你还需要填写页面的路径、按钮的名称等一系列配置参数,对于产品或者运营人员来说,这是一件成本和门槛都很高的事情。
另一方面,官方还没有来源统计的数据。
2. 自定义/第三方埋点统计
这是一个年代比较久远的、被大家认可的统计方法,就是埋点。为每一个用户行为定义一个事件,事件触发的时候上报,它的优点是什么数据都能统计。

埋点的缺点是部署的成本高,一方面是埋点需要开发人员加入、需要很多开发或者规划的时间。同时,不埋点就没有数据,漏埋、错埋都没有正确的数据,而且埋点的话数据是不可以回溯的。
所以这需要非常精心的设计,操作中成本非常高。
3. 无埋点统计
无埋点,这是近些年比较火的统计方法。无论是网页、app 还是小程序,一次性集成 SDK,就可以采集页面访问、点击行为、用户特征等全量数据。
你需要做的就是定义指标,然后就可以灵活进行自定义分析了。
在无埋点的基础上,补充必要的人工配置,可以非常轻松、高效地完成主要的数据统计和监控工作。
掌握了正确的数据统计方式,不仅能了解用户的人群特征,指定个性体验,还可以作为商户本身的一面镜子,有哪些优点和哪些不足。小程序数据统计,也是小程序趋于完善的必经之路。 参考技术A 2017年6月13日,小程序码已经是当下最热门的话题,下面将从多方面来谈谈微信小程序码发布数量相关的内容。
2017年6月13日微店发布最新公告,决定调整补贴策略:借记卡支付仍然免费、提现仍然免费,对使用信用卡支付的交易收取1%的手续费。微店方面表示,此举是为了防范信用卡恶意套现,新规将从2017年6月16日起实行。值得注意的是,这笔手续费由卖家承担。
2017年6月13日在618大促即将开启之际,天猫于今天宣布“天猫出海”项目正式推出。天猫方面表示,“天猫出海”是以天猫作为主引擎,利用阿里巴巴核心电商板块20亿商品,将天猫生态模式逐步成功复制并落地到东南亚、印度以及全球市场,提高当地电商效率,服务海外消费者。
废话不多说,今天凌晨微信小程序发布了功能更新消息,包括:小程序码数量不再设限、模板消息功能提升、小程序数据分析功能。
小程序码生成数量无限制
大家都知道,开发者若想精准识别到用户是在哪里扫码进入小程序的,需要在不同地方投放不同的小程序码才能实现。
当小程序码的生成数量不受限,意味着商家的投放可以有更多的空间。商家将这些独一无二的小程序码配置在不同的物料上,开发者通过追踪到用户都是从哪儿识别进入到小程序,让商家清楚了解到各物料的投放效果。
另外,还可以按照实际的需求,生成即时使用的小程序码,不必像过去一样担心限额数量的浪费。
支付后消息可多次触达
模板信息功能提升。用户在支付成功后,支持商家在7天内下发3条模板消息,将消息多次触达到用户,如:提醒用户订单,物流状态的变更等等,可以更好地增强用户粘性,提升售后服务质量。
数据分析
1.支持查看小程序新增活跃用户的性别、年龄、地区、设备分布,开发者可以在后台或者小程序数据助手清晰地了解到每个用户的“用户画像”,更好地分析小程序数据,在此基础上做更精准的决策。(数据每天早上更新) 参考技术B 1、先开发小程序,小程序需要有亮点,毕竟新颖(这样别人才更好去点击查看)。
2、流量主开通的条件是独立访客(UV)不低于1000,1000人说多不多,说少也不少,因为小程序是没有链接的,是不可以进行一个流量刷取的,独立访客是需要1000个实实在在的用户,并不是访问量。
3、开发好小程序之后,自己要为自己的小程序做好宣传,前提小程序需要做的完美,小程序一定要做分享功能,将小程序分享到个人、微信群、朋友圈,这样估计很容易就达到几百了。 参考技术C 1. 使用微信小程序的基础数据库,它可以存储大量数据,如文本、图片、音视频等;
2. 使用微信小程序的网络请求,可以通过与服务器的交互来获取大量数据;
3. 使用微信小程序的调用本地文件,可以从本地文件中获取大量数据;
4. 使用微信小程序的缓存,可以将大量数据存储在本地,以便下次使用。
以上是关于微信小程序 navigationbar怎么配置的主要内容,如果未能解决你的问题,请参考以下文章